Abstract
The present invention relates to plantation farm technology field,In particular multifunctional quantitatively seeding apparatus,Including fixed plate,The fixed plate left end is provided with roller,The fixed plate right-hand member is fixedly connected with tie-beam,The fixed plate top is from left to right sequentially provided with seed-storage box,Receptacle and water tank,The material storing box exit is provided with Quantitative seeder,Trench digging colter is fixed with the left of the material storing box of the fixed plate bottom,Receptacle bottom discharge nozzle is provided with screw rod,The screw rod is rotatablely connected with discharge nozzle,And fixed plate bottom is connected with reverse colter on the right side of discharge nozzle,It is described to be reversely provided with firming device on the right side of colter,The fixed plate right-hand member offers opening with tie-beam junction,And opening left side fixed plate top is fixed with isocon,The isocon bottom is fixedly connected with multiple shower nozzles,The present apparatus can realize trench digging,Sowing,Fertilising,Banket,Pour,Whole seeding process is disposably completed,Can large area sowing,It is good to plant income,It is worthy to be popularized.

Compared with prior art, the beneficial effects of the invention are as follows:
1st, in the present invention, soil can be ditched by the trench digging colter of setting, facilitates followed by automatic sowing, applies
Fertilizer, it is not necessary to manually ditched, it is convenient and swift, save labour;
2nd, can be to will be broadcast automatically in the groove held successfully by the material storing box, receptacle and water tank of setting in the present invention
Kind, fertilising, pour, whole seeding process is disposably completed, saves substantial amounts of manpower, have huge economic benefit;
3rd, in the present invention, it can will be ditched by the reverse colter of setting in the soil backfill road groove dug out, then pass through pressure
Native device will loosen the soil compacting, ensure planting effect, science simple in construction, be worthy to be popularized;
4th, in the present invention, whole device can be connected to by the tie-beam of setting by large-sized diesel stroller front end, pass through stroller
Driving device carries out automation plantation, it is possible to achieve large area is cultivated, and automaticity is high, efficiency high, can bring huge warp
Ji income;
5th, in the present invention, by the Quantitative seeder of setting the promotion of roller can be utilized to drive rotating disk to rotate realization and quantitatively broadcast
Kind, sowing is uniform, and planting effect is good.
